Stewart Town, Gaithersburg, MD Guía Local

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Stewart Town?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Stewart Town | $1,670 | $1,300 | $2,009 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Stewart Town | $1,767 | $1,157 | $2,309 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Stewart Town | $2,042 | $1,400 | $2,846 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Stewart Town | $2,478 | $1,570 | $3,763 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Stewart Town | $3,060 | $2,196 | $3,700 |
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ar una casa en Stewart Town?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Casas con 2 Dormitorios | $2,172 | $1,850 | $2,500 |
| Casas con 3 Dormitorios | $2,769 | $1,100 | $4,000 |
| Casas con 4 Dormitorios | $3,216 | $2,450 | $4,300 |
| Casas con 5 Dormitorios | $3,691 | $3,100 | $4,650 |
| Casas con 6 Dormitorios | $3,500 | $3,500 | $3,500 |
